Output 1717e997358d77866946a7a38ef01187ee98b4c1cc4d9b8bc6e64057a39cf8be:5

value
289691889
script pubkey
OP_0 OP_PUSHBYTES_20 8d4d42ba91e83c18eb11e94208bd18a973ceeb31
address
bc1q34x59w53aq7p36c3a9pq30gc49eua6e3g4kg76
transaction
1717e997358d77866946a7a38ef01187ee98b4c1cc4d9b8bc6e64057a39cf8be